A TASTE OF SICILY & BAROQUE TOWNS
This adventure takes you across the exotic island of Sicily from Palermo to the southeast baroque region of Modica and Siracusa. Experience the local specialties, a hands-on cooking class with a master of authentic Sicilian cuisine, visit markets and taste wines from the different regions. A Taste of Sicily is the perfect combination to taste your way across Sicily.
DAY 1 Palermo Our week long adventure begins with a walking tour through the bustling streets of Palermo to the Vucciria market. Vibrant and lively, vendors sell their just picked produce, mounds of olives, cheeses, spices and fresh catches of the day and sample local street food specialties. Continue on to Palermo’s Catherdral, Quattro Canti, known as the “four corners”, Piazza Pretoria and it’s magnificent baroque sculpture filled fountain, and the Opera house and hilltop town of Monreale and its stunning Byzantine mosaic filled Duomo. Enjoy dinner at a local hot spot and explore the city. B, D
DAY 2 Modica After breakfast, we’ll
travel to the center of the island to legendary Anna Tasca’s cooking class. You
will spend the afternoon in her century old villa preparing authentic Sicilian
dishes along with the history that created them. Or if you prefer you can watch
or walk the vineyards until lunch. All products are from their farm, from
the eggs and cheese, to garden vegetables and olive oil, to of course the vino!
Take a nap or watch the landscape go by on your way to the baroque city of
Modica. B, L
Day 3 Modica Today you will enjoy a walking tour of Modica, it’s historical sites and lesser known local areas. Then stop for a private tourand tasting at world famous Bonajuto chocolate shop, whose methods date back to the Aztecs and Spaniards. Many chocolate treats spiked with spicy chili and cinnamon to the best traditional sweet ricotta filled cannoli’s. Visit Castello Donnafugata fpr guided tour and free time to walk and explore the gardens. The evening is yours to enjoy Modica’s rustic delicacies such as scacci and arrancini and local wine and cheeses. B, D
Day 4 Modica After breakfast visit the baroque village of Ragusa,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, famous for its caciocavallo and fresh ricotta cheeses. This afternoon enjoy a rustic lunch among the vineyards and olive groves at one of Sicily’s top wineries. It an organic winery producing local varietals like Cerasoula and Nero d’Avola and see the unique wine making process in amphoras (clay urns) dating back to ancient Rome. B, L
Day 5 Siracusa This morning continue on to Siracusa, Ortygia, known as, Citta Vecchia, the old city of Siracusa first inhabited by the Greeks. A UNESCO World Heritage Site, this little island is filled with medieval and baroque monuments. Lunch at a local trattoria. This evening is free to explore the narrow streets, shops and restaurants or even take in a long standing traditional Sicilian performance at the puppet theatre. B, L
Day 6 Siracusa Today our local guide will take us to the market, visit the Duomo and Santa Lucia piazza. On our walking tour we’ll visit a fewshops to sample local artisan cheeses and wines, visit one of Siracusa’s best pasticceria’s creating traditional Sicilian cassata, cannoli, delicious almond cookies pasta di mandorle. Next, visit the Greek Amphitheater dating back to 5th century BC and the Ear of Dionysis, the cave possess amazing acoustical properties. Dinner is at one of Sicily’s best pizzeria’s. B, L, D
